Holladay resides in a landscape shaped by the gentle, persistent hand of water and time. It lies 28.0 miles north of Montgomery, TN (from Montgomery, TN: bearing 1°T), and is situated 19.4 miles north-west of Perry. The terrain here is a subtle tapestry of rolling hills, not dramatic peaks, but soft swells that cradle small farms and wooded draws. Creeks, often no more than a murmur after dry spells, swell into determined streams after rains, their banks lined with stoic oaks and resilient sycamores. The history of Holladay is intertwined with the agricultural bounty of its fertile soil and the quiet ambition of its inhabitants. For generations, this corner of Benton County has been defined by its connection to the land, with farming forming the backbone of its economy. Corn and soybeans are the familiar crops that stretch across the fields, their orderly rows a testament to the enduring rhythm of planting and harvest.
